About The Role

We are looking for an experienced Sales Trainer to design and deliver effective training

programs for our admissions and sales teams.

The role will focus on sales onboarding, product training, communication skills, sales

techniques, objection handling, call quality, and continuous performance coaching. The Sales

Trainer will work closely with sales leadership to identify skill gaps and build training

interventions that directly contribute to improved conversion and revenue performance.

The ideal candidate should have strong hands-on experience in sales training, coaching, call

audits, and performance improvement, preferably within EdTech, Education, B2C, Inside

Sales, or a high-volume sales environment.

Key Responsibilities

Sales Training & Development

 Design and deliver training programs for new and existing sales teams.

 Conduct structured onboarding programs for new sales hires.

 Train teams on sales processes, customer engagement, product knowledge, and sales

techniques.

 Develop training modules, presentations, role plays, activities, and assessments.

 Conduct refresher and upskilling sessions based on business requirements.

Sales Skills & Conversion Training

 Train sales teams on consultative selling and effective sales conversations.

 Coach teams on probing, need identification, pitching, and closing techniques.

 Develop strong objection-handling and negotiation capabilities.

 Train counsellors on creating urgency and effectively communicating product value.

 Improve conversion through structured sales coaching interventions.

Call Audits & Quality Improvement

 Conduct regular call audits to assess sales conversations and customer handling.

 Identify gaps in communication, pitch quality, product knowledge, and objection

handling.

 Provide actionable feedback and individual coaching to sales representatives.

 Track recurring quality issues and create targeted training interventions.

 Work with sales managers to improve overall call quality and conversion

performance.

Performance Coaching

 Analyse individual and team performance to identify training requirements.

 Conduct one-on-one coaching sessions for underperforming team members.

 Work with Sales Managers and Team Leads to create improvement plans.

 Monitor the effectiveness of training through post-training performance metrics.

 Continuously identify opportunities to improve sales productivity and conversion.

Product & Process Training

 Develop strong understanding of 21K School's programs, offerings, admission

process, and customer journey.

 Train sales teams on product positioning and communicating key value propositions.

 Ensure teams are aligned with updated sales processes, policies, and communication

standards.

 Conduct regular knowledge checks and assessments.

Training Content & Reporting

 Create and maintain training materials, SOPs, sales scripts, and learning resources.

 Maintain training calendars and track completion and participation.

 Prepare regular reports on training effectiveness and team performance.

 Measure training impact through metrics such as conversion, productivity, call

quality, and sales performance.

Cross-Functional Collaboration

 Work closely with Sales Managers, Team Leads, HR, and Revenue Leadership to

identify capability gaps.

 Collaborate with leadership to align training programs with business and revenue

goals.

 Support new product, process, or campaign launches through focused sales training.

 Provide insights to sales leadership based on call audits and training observations.
